Battery and alternator voltages are correct. But you just "confirmed" my theory: 2 Glow-plugs burned, which caused a short under or over voltage, which triggered the first few diagnose error codes. (I deleted all of them, drove already more than 1000 km, and only 2 glow-plug errors are coming back.)
Glow-plug relay was exchanged 2 years ago. At that time, as you said, the error codes of all 6 glow-plugs were always there.
I agree with you now: it is not the DPF... But I do not agree with you that the Check engine light will definitely go on.
I really have a lot of mileages on my car (~500.000 km), so the DPF was already clogged once. No Check engine light came up. I just lost the power, was able to drive max 80 km/h. I was on high-way, pressing the accelerator pedal was actually acting vice versa.

Regarding the DPF, that's weird, mine Check engine light came on with an iDrive message "Emissions fault" maybe we have a different year or maybe different software version

Regarding the diagnoistics tool - buy an K+Dcan cable (I bought mine from Amazon for like 28USD) without the software and then downloaded software from internet (Mike's easy BMW tools & ISTA+)
